The Native vs. Cross-Platform Dilemma
Historically, native app development—using Swift for Apple and Kotlin or Java for Android—was the only way to ensure high performance and access to specific device features like the camera, GPS, or push notifications. However, this required hiring two distinct development teams, doubling both the timeline and the budget.
Cross-platform development frameworks changed the game by allowing developers to write a single codebase that deploys natively across multiple operating systems. Early iterations of this technology were often clunky, but modern frameworks have bridged the performance gap entirely.
Leading the Charge: React Native and Flutter
The surge in cross-platform popularity is largely driven by two powerhouse frameworks:
- React Native: Created by Meta, this framework allows developers to use JavaScript to build mobile apps that feel entirely native. It powers massive applications like Instagram, Airbnb, and UberEats.
- Flutter: Backed by Google, Flutter uses the Dart programming language and provides a rich set of pre-built UI components. It is known for its incredibly fast performance and expressive, flexible designs.
Key Advantages of Cross-Platform Development
If you are planning to build a mobile app in today's market, leveraging a cross-platform strategy offers massive, tangible benefits to your bottom line and operational efficiency:
- Faster Time-to-Market: By writing the code once, you can launch on both the Apple App Store and Google Play simultaneously, getting your product into users' hands months faster than native development.
- Cost Efficiency: Maintaining one codebase halves your development and ongoing maintenance costs. Updates, bug fixes, and new features only need to be coded once.
- Uniform UX/UI: Cross-platform frameworks ensure your brand experience, animations, and user interface remain completely consistent regardless of the device your customer uses.
- Wider Audience Reach: You do not have to choose whether to target iOS users or Android users first. You capture the entire mobile market on day one.

Is Cross-Platform Right for Your Business?
While there are still rare edge cases where a purely native app is required—such as highly complex 3D gaming or apps requiring intense, low-level hardware manipulation—cross-platform development is the optimal choice for 95% of business applications. E-commerce platforms, SaaS companions, internal enterprise tools, and social networks all thrive on cross-platform architectures.
